Understanding Laser Therapy
Laser therapy involves the use of concentrated light beams to treat different skin conditions. It is commonly used for hair removal, acne treatment, skin rejuvenation, and tattoo removal. The procedure can cause temporary redness, swelling, and sensitivity in the treated area. Therefore, it is crucial to follow post-treatment care instructions to ensure optimal healing and avoid complications.
Dietary Considerations After Laser Therapy
While there are no specific dietary restrictions post-laser therapy, certain foods can influence the healing process. Here are some aspects to consider:
1. Inflammation and Anti-Inflammatory Foods
Laser therapy can cause inflammation in the treated area. Consuming anti-inflammatory foods can help reduce inflammation and promote healing. Foods rich in omega-3 fatty acids, such as salmon and flaxseeds, are known to have anti-inflammatory properties. On the other hand, pro-inflammatory foods like processed meats and sugary beverages should be avoided.
2. Skin Sensitivity and Allergic Reactions
Seafood, including shrimp, can sometimes trigger allergic reactions in some individuals. If you have a known seafood allergy, it is advisable to avoid shrimp and other seafood products post-laser therapy to prevent any adverse reactions that could complicate the healing process. If you are unsure about your allergy status, consult your healthcare provider for guidance.
3. Nutrition and Healing
A well-balanced diet is essential for proper healing after any medical procedure. Ensure you consume sufficient protein, vitamins, and minerals to support skin regeneration. Shrimp is a good source of protein and contains essential nutrients like zinc and selenium, which are beneficial for skin health. However, if you have any concerns about incorporating shrimp into your diet post-laser therapy, consult your healthcare provider.
4. Hydration and Skin Health
Staying hydrated is crucial for maintaining skin health and promoting healing. Drink plenty of water and avoid excessive consumption of alcohol and caffeinated beverages, which can dehydrate the skin. Proper hydration helps maintain the skin's elasticity and supports the healing process.
5. Avoiding Irritants
Certain foods and beverages can act as irritants and should be avoided post-laser therapy. Spicy foods, acidic fruits, and highly caffeinated drinks can exacerbate skin sensitivity and delay healing. It is best to stick to a mild and balanced diet to minimize any potential irritants.

FAQ
Q: Can I eat shrimp immediately after laser therapy?
A: It is generally safe to eat shrimp after laser therapy, but it is advisable to wait until any initial redness or swelling subsides. If you have a seafood allergy, avoid shrimp and consult your healthcare provider.
Q: Are there any specific foods I should avoid after laser therapy?
A: Avoid pro-inflammatory foods, highly acidic foods, and potential allergens that could trigger adverse reactions. Stick to a balanced diet rich in anti-inflammatory foods and hydrating beverages.
Q: How long should I wait before resuming my normal diet after laser therapy?
A: There are no strict timelines for resuming your normal diet. However, it is best to follow a mild and balanced diet for the first few days post-treatment to support healing and avoid potential irritants.
Q: Can certain foods enhance the results of laser therapy?
A: While there is no direct evidence that specific foods can enhance laser therapy results, a healthy and balanced diet can support overall skin health and promote healing.
Q: Should I avoid seafood altogether after laser therapy?
A: No, there is no need to avoid seafood altogether unless you have a known allergy. Shrimp, in particular, can be a part of a balanced diet post-laser therapy, as it provides essential nutrients for skin health.
